- Poland
- https://mozillabd.science/wiki/17_Reasons_You_Shouldnt_Not_Ignore_French_Door_Installation_Near_Me
-
Upgrade your home with expert French door installation services by the top-rated French Door Installation Company. Transform your space today!
- Joined on
2025-11-26
Block a user
Sort